Lucas Pardue

Results 462 comments of Lucas Pardue

Agreed both are useful! I just think it helps to be upfront with the community that QUIC performance metrics don't directly infer real-world application mapping performance. Your proposal for "perf"...

HTTP header size limits are really a best effort hint, especially given the nature of HTTP intermediation and version translation. In a proxy chain, you've already had to advertise the...

Finished should fire if you've read all the data sent on the stream up until the Fin. Do you have a pcap or qlog of the case where you see...

Hmm, that does seem weird. Do you have any instructions for running this test setup that would allow us to try and repro?

I don't have many spare cycles to get anything complicated running, which is going to make investigating this hard. Maybe you can provide a curl trace log too just so...

I _think_ I might have emulated the sequence in https://github.com/cloudflare/quiche/pull/2278 but it would be great to see if curl client sees the same order of events.

Taking any automated action in response to a X_DATA_BLOCKED frame seems like a bad idea IMO. Thats an easy way to surprise users of the library and trigger DoS via...

> I am confused. Is FlowControl::autotune_window disabled on h3.speed.cloudflare.com? Or are you suggesting h3.speed.cloudflare.com should more agressively do auto tuning? Apologies, I misremembered how the flow control autotuning worked (I...

> I think this ratio (# STREAM / # BLOCKED) is misleading. E.g. say a client is blocked for 1 RTT, that would result in 1 STREAM_DATA_BLOCKED frame, but potentially...

Speaking as an individual: the opinion in https://github.com/httpwg/http-extensions/issues/3192#issue-3311909127 does not sufficiently reflect the variety of heterogenous networks that this document is designed for. For instance, a path with high throughput...